Visite privée de la faune sauvage à la plage d'Avellanas





Description
Joignez-vous à nous pour une promenade de 2,5 heures à travers les forêts et les sentiers d'Avellanas, à la découverte de la faune et des plantes uniques de notre quartier côtier. Heure de début flexible: Choisissez entre 6h30 et 15h30 Nous explorerons une boucle de 2 miles, révélant des sentiers cachés et des endroits inconnus même des habitants. Attendez-vous à voir des singes vocaux, des oiseaux tropicaux colorés et de minuscules crustacés nichés entre les marées -Promenade à travers 4 écosystèmes différents: lisière de forêt, mangroves, estuaire, et plage intertidale -Repère une faune fascinante qui vit dans la région -Apprenez l'histoire derrière le pont emblématique d'Avellanas -Découvrez pourquoi les forêts de mangroves sont l'un des écosystèmes les plus riches de la planète terre -Aidez à protéger ces habitats avec un nettoyage rapide des sentiers pendant notre visite. Itinéraire
Commencez à explorer la forêt tropicale sèche, en repérant des oiseaux, des mammifères et des reptiles.
Entrez dans la forêt de mangroves et l'estuaire, où l'eau douce rencontre l'eau salée, créant un habitat riche pour la faune diversifiée.
Traversez l'estuaire où les rivières rejoignent l'océan. *pendant les heures de marée haute, nous pouvons être mouillés jusqu'à la taille.
Marchez sur la plage en découvrant les coquillages et les dollars de sable dans la zone intertidale
Terminez la promenade en atteignant l'emblématique pont de la Mangrove de Rochelles, symbole de conservation.
